![]() Although Brian is not quite in the same league as long-time jazz players like Jimmy Smith, he still does pretty well for a young Brit upstart. Also, his band does a great job of laying down funky swinging grooves and the guitar playing is outstanding. I don't know why most later Auger albums have such mediocre guitarists, its nice to hear him being pushed by someone with comparable chops. There are a couple of vocal numbers on this record, but they seem like filler compared to the instrumentals. This style of rocking jazz hipster lounge music enjoyed a resurgance of popularity in the early to mid-90s when acid jazz DJs would place cuts like these along side instrumental hip-hop numbers. This record is not for everyone, but if you enjoy this kind of fun retro music this album is great.
